Output 69fd174d22569c6b91cf797f6799dcd2c1eedef7b555c76e1791f5f508bb9f9e:1

value
21303090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735451199a134636e5a0d187f0b53606aa7d675e OP_EQUAL
address
3CCpe3A77aa3QmqeoD5zJ7QNVwGUbpaFuE
transaction
69fd174d22569c6b91cf797f6799dcd2c1eedef7b555c76e1791f5f508bb9f9e
spent
true